首先需要在git官网将程序下载下来(若无特别需要安装过程中可全部选择默认),并在github上注册一个个人账号来创建一个远程代码仓库。
git安装完成后在文件夹内部单击鼠标右键即会出现git的命令
点击 Git Bash here进入终端后输入
- $ git init
即可建立一个本地工作区
通过输入
- $ git add [文件地址]
可将在工作区中的文件加入到暂存区中
然后输入
- $ git status
可获取在工作区中所有文件的上传状态
其中绿色的文件代表已经上传到暂存区但未提交到历史区,红色的文件代表在工作区中未上传的文件(\XXX是中文的转码)
最后,通过输入
- $ git commit [文件地址](可不填写) -m '描述信息’
将在暂存区里面的文件提交到历史区中
通过使用
- $ git log
按Q退出该模式
可查看历史提交(commit)信息
其中黄色的部分为提交的版本号,可通过前7位来进行操作版本(例如使用reset命令)
若想将文件存放到github保存,则需要将本地与远程仓库进行链接
- $ git remote add origin(链接名称) [仓库地址]
- $ git remote -v(查看成功链接的信息)
- $ git remote rm origin (删除链接信息)
在将commit的文件上传到远程仓库前,首先需要拉取仓库内容到本地(获取其他上传者提交的内容)。
- $ git pull origin master(拉取仓库内容)
- $ git push origin master(提交内容到仓库)
(分支上的内容可不加[链接] master)
上传完成后,就可以在GitHub上看到自己上传的文件了
切换项目分支
$ git checkout [分支名]
(注意,checkout会回滚版本,使用前请留意是否做好了保存)
将分支内容与主干合并
首先切换到主干后
$ git merge [项目链接名称]/[分支名称]